Cultural Heritage Assessments
In Ontario provincial legislation requires that cultural heritage be considered when developments and property alterations are considered.
Detritus Consulting provides a full range of Cultural Heritage Assessment services including, Cultural Heritage Evaluation Reports, Heritage Impact Assessments, Built Heritage Assessments, and Cultural Heritage Landscape Evaluations.
The Ministry of Heritage, Sport, Tourism, and Cultural Industries has developed the Ontario Heritage Tool Kit (gov.on.ca) to assist in understanding the legislation and tools available for the conservation of cultural heritage resources.
Maritime Archaeological Assessments
Under the Ontario Heritage Act, a “marine archaeological site” is an archaeological site that is fully or partially submerged or that lies below or partially below the high-water mark of any body of water. (O. Reg. 170/04, s. 1.).
Marine archaeological assessments may be required to supplement or in addition to terrestrial archaeological assessment.
Detritus can conduct marine archaeological assessments to identify and evaluate the presence of marine archaeological resources and outline measures to mitigate the impact of development on these resources.


Heritage Management
To manage and mitigate known or potential archaeological resources proponents, municipalities and approval authorities can utilize several heritage management options including archaeological management plans and strategic conservation plans.
Detritus consulting can develop archaeological management plans to ensure that concerns for archaeological resources are identified and mitigated early in the development process.
While strategic conservation plans can target specific properties with cultural heritage value even within an archaeological management plan for the long-term protection of cultural heritage resources.
